**Q: How does Formulon sandbox user-supplied formulas?**

Every formula entered by a customer runs inside an isolated evaluator with no filesystem, network, or clock access. The parser rejects anything outside our whitelisted function set before execution begins, and each evaluation has a hard 50ms budget enforced by the Quarrel runtime. Never bypass the sandbox for debugging, even locally, since test inputs may contain real customer data. The full threat model and escape-hatch policy are documented on our internal page.

dashboard of bafof-hafog = https://confluence.lumiclabs.internal/display/browse/display/6a09a20a

## v2.11.3 — Read-replica lag alarm overhaul

Reworked the replica lag alarm for the Fenwick datastore cluster. The alarm now measures applied-transaction lag rather than wall-clock heartbeat delta, which eliminated the false positives we saw during nightly vacuum windows. Thresholds are configurable per replica pool, with a default of 30s warning and 120s critical. Reviewers should pay attention to the new hysteresis logic in `lag_monitor.go`, which suppresses flapping. The change was implemented and is owned by the engineer named below.

signatory, hawep-fahof: Ralwyn Casdor

Subject: Cut-over done — DNS flakiness resolved (mostly)

Hi all, quick recap for the sync. We finished the cut-over of the Pellworth resolver fleet last night. The flaky lookups turned out to be the old caching layer racing on negative TTLs — fun times. New resolvers have been stable for 14 hours, p99 lookup under 8ms. One retry storm early on, self-healed. We'll keep the old fleet warm for a week just in case. For the record, the new fleet runs with these settings.

deployment values, kajep-kageg:
[praix]
host = praix.paliqcorp.corp
user = praix_svc
database = praix_prod